Good positive movie :)
This movie really teaches you a lot! It focuses on mental health (like Mirabel’s loneliness due to not getting a gift), intergenerational trauma (When Abuelo died), and most importantly, it provides a message that someone isn’t just what you see with your eyes. They could be struggling with anything. And the songs and plot may be confusing for children 10 and under (they might not understand mental health and stuff like that) but they are a super positive message reflecting negative things that most families with children in them of today suffer. I recommend this!

Heart-breaking, yet worth watching
This movie, "Encanto", is based on a Colombian family, called the Madrigal's, who live in a magical Casita (house). Every room is customized to foster the special powers and talents of each family member, tailoring in their needs, all except for one: Mirabel.
Throughout this authentic film, viewers will embark with Mirabel on a relatable journey of exploring identity, self-acceptance, the importance of family, and willing to be understanding and open to change.
